What Whisper Mountain Homeowners Association's governing documents say
Whisper Mountain is a single-family homeowners association (HOA) in Mesa, Arizona. The HOA enforces rules on renting, parking, pets, and exterior changes through a Board and an Architectural Review Committee (ARC). These rules apply to homeowners and their tenants.
- Leasing & rentals: You may only rent the entire lot or dwelling unit to a single family. No business or non-residential use is allowed on the property.
- Pets: Dogs must be on a leash while on association property. Owners must clean up after their pets. Specific limits on number or type are not stated in these excerpts; see CC&R Section 7.3 for full restrictions.
- Parking & vehicles: No vehicle over 3/4 ton, mobile home, travel trailer, camper, boat, or similar equipment may be parked visible from neighboring property. Temporary loading/unloading allowed for 48 hours. No commercial vehicles on lots or streets. All vehicles must be parked in garage, carport, or driveway. Inoperable vehicles or those with expired tags are prohibited.
- Architectural review (ARC): Any exterior change (including paint, landscaping, structures) requires prior written approval from the ARC. Submit an application; the ARC responds within 30 days. Decisions may be appealed to the Board. The Board can also temporarily act as the ARC.
- Trash & storage: Trash must be in covered containers and stored out of sight except on collection days. Containers in rear yards must be screened with a wall or landscaping that matches the house or perimeter wall, and requires ARC approval.
